Hyrax Oil Signs Agreement to Construct Lubricant Manufacturing Plant in Sri Lanka

colombopage.com, May 07,’16

Hyrax Oil, a Malaysian manufacturer of petroleum derivatives with a vast customer base worldwide will be investing US$ 30 million to establish four million liters per month lubricant blending plant in Muthurajawela in western Sri Lanka.  Three agreements were signed between Hyrax Oil and Sri Lanka’s petroleum authority, Ceylon Petroleum Corporation. The agreements that were signed are for a build, operate and transfer  agreement, a supply agreement and a land lease agreement. Hyrax Oil will construct the plant and subsequently manufacture the lubricant products for CPC for a term of 20 years.
The construction of the plant will start within two months, and it is expected to be completed within a year.
